Key Features
- Exceptional Durability: Rated PEI 4-5 for intense commercial use, resisting abrasion from high foot traffic and equipment.
- Superior Slip Resistance: R10-R12 ratings with textured surfaces, compliant with DIN 51130 and ADA standards for safety in wet areas.
- Low Water Absorption: Under 0.5% for porcelain variants, preventing moisture damage and mold growth in humid environments.
- Aesthetic Versatility: Over 500 designs including wood-look, stone-effect, and geometric patterns in matte, gloss, and polished finishes.
- Easy Maintenance: Non-porous surface requires only sweeping and neutral pH cleaners, minimizing downtime.
- Rectified Edges: Precision-cut for minimal grout joints (1-2mm), creating a modern, seamless appearance.
- Thermal Stability: Withstands temperature fluctuations from -20°C to 120°C, suitable for underfloor heating systems.
- Custom Sizing: Standard and bespoke dimensions to fit unique commercial layouts without excessive cutting.
- Greenguard Certified: Low VOC emissions for improved indoor air quality in occupied spaces.
- Anti-Bacterial Glaze: Nano-silver technology inhibits bacterial growth, ideal for healthcare and food service areas.
Technical Specifications

| Parameter | Specification | Test Standard |
|---|---|---|
| Material | Porcelain/Ceramic Body | ISO 13006 |
| Size Options | 300x300mm, 600x600mm, 600x1200mm, 800x800mm, 1200x2400mm (custom available) | - |
| Thickness | 8-12mm | - |
| Water Absorption | ≤0.5% (Porcelain), ≤3% (Ceramic) | ISO 10545-3 |
| PEI Rating | Class 4-5 | ISO 10545-7 |
| Slip Resistance (Dry) | R10-R12 | DIN 51130 |
| Slip Resistance (Wet) | DCOF ≥0.42 | ANSI A137.1 |
| Breaking Strength | ≥800N | ISO 10545-4 |
| Frost Resistance | Pass (≤0.5% absorption) | ISO 10545-12 |
| Rectified | Yes (for large formats) | - |
| Finish Options | Matte, Gloss, Polished, Textured | - |
| Weight per sqm | 18-25kg | - |
| Shade Variation | V2-V3 | ANSI A137.1 |
Application Scenarios
Commercial ceramic tile flooring excels in diverse high-demand settings where reliability and style intersect. In retail spaces like shopping malls and boutiques, large-format tiles with stone or marble effects create inviting walkways that handle thousands of daily visitors without showing wear. For corporate offices and lobbies, sleek wood-look planks offer warmth and sophistication, paired with underfloor heating for year-round comfort.
Hospitality venues such as hotels, restaurants, and cafes benefit from slip-resistant, easy-clean surfaces that maintain hygiene amid spills and heavy use. In healthcare facilities, anti-bacterial glazed tiles ensure compliance with infection control standards, while their durability supports medical equipment mobility. Educational institutions and public buildings utilize textured finishes for safety on stairs and corridors.
Industrial-commercial hybrids like showrooms, warehouses, and gyms opt for our robust, chemical-resistant options. Outdoor terraces and covered patios leverage frost-proof qualities for all-weather performance. FAQ
What makes commercial ceramic tile flooring suitable for high-traffic areas?
Its PEI 4-5 rating and reinforced body endure abrasion from foot traffic, carts, and furniture, outlasting alternatives.
Is commercial ceramic tile flooring slip-resistant?
Yes, with R10-R12 dry ratings and DCOF ≥0.42 wet, meeting global safety standards for public spaces.
Can it be used outdoors?
Absolutely—frost-resistant porcelain variants with low absorption perform reliably in exterior applications.
How do I maintain commercial ceramic tile flooring?
Sweep daily, mop with pH-neutral cleaner weekly; avoid abrasives to preserve the glaze.
What sizes are available for commercial ceramic tile flooring?
From 300x300mm mosaics to 1200x2400mm slabs, plus custom cuts for any layout.
Is it compatible with underfloor heating?
Yes, thermal conductivity supports systems up to 120°C without cracking.
